Permalink
Commits on Apr 27, 2010
  1. Checking in changes prior to tagging of version 0.9933.

    miyagawa committed Apr 27, 2010
    Changelog diff is:
    
    diff --git a/Changes b/Changes
    index 35539ea..0e425db 100644
    --- a/Changes
    +++ b/Changes
    @@ -2,6 +2,12 @@ Revision history for Perl extension Plack
    
     Take a look at http://github.com/miyagawa/Plack/issues for the planned changes before 1.0 release.
    
    +0.9933  Tue Apr 27 14:32:23 PDT 2010
    +        - refactored the app.psgi loading error handling
    +        - Enable type checking of the app in Lint->wrap
    +        - allow plackup -e'...'
    +        - Disable FCGI::Client/Net::FastCGI test by default
    +
     0.9932  Mon Apr 19 15:23:55 JST 2010
             - Enable Lint middleware by default in the development env
             - Lint middleware now validates $app on startup
  2. allow -e'' (without spaces)

    miyagawa committed Apr 27, 2010
Commits on Apr 21, 2010
  1. fixed docs

    miyagawa committed Apr 21, 2010
Commits on Apr 20, 2010
  1. fixed msg

    miyagawa committed Apr 20, 2010
  2. Changed an obscure error message that confused me.

    juster committed Apr 20, 2010
    The loader used to die if the .psgi file returned undef.  Now the
    loader won't die but will just complain that an app wasn't returned.
    
    While learning Plack I accidentally made my sub in the .psgi like this:
    
    sub app {
     ...
    }
    
    When I ran plackup it gave me a cryptic error:
    Can't load test.psgi: Died at (eval 7) line 1.
    
    Guh? Now it gives a better error:
    test.psgi did not return a PSGI app handler code reference.
    Instead it returned: <undef> at lib/Plack/Runner.pm line 169
Commits on Apr 19, 2010
  1. Checking in changes prior to tagging of version 0.9932.

    miyagawa committed Apr 19, 2010
    Changelog diff is:
    
    diff --git a/Changes b/Changes
    index 6f7c6ca..35539ea 100644
    --- a/Changes
    +++ b/Changes
    @@ -2,6 +2,11 @@ Revision history for Perl extension Plack
    
     Take a look at http://github.com/miyagawa/Plack/issues for the planned changes before 1.0 release.
    
    +0.9932  Mon Apr 19 15:23:55 JST 2010
    +        - Enable Lint middleware by default in the development env
    +        - Lint middleware now validates $app on startup
    +        - Fixed documentations on middleware and handlers
    +
     0.9931  Fri Apr 16 23:52:27 PDT 2010
             - replace kyoto.jpg test image file with smaller baybridge.jpg to strip down the tarball size
               from 2.5MB to 212KB.
  2. updated Handler docs

    miyagawa committed Apr 19, 2010
  3. s/Server/Handler/g

    miyagawa committed Apr 19, 2010
  4. document loaders

    miyagawa committed Apr 19, 2010
  5. document middleware

    miyagawa committed Apr 19, 2010
Commits on Apr 17, 2010
  1. Checking in changes prior to tagging of version 0.9931.

    miyagawa committed Apr 17, 2010
    Changelog diff is:
    
    diff --git a/Changes b/Changes
    index 341971f..6f7c6ca 100644
    --- a/Changes
    +++ b/Changes
    @@ -2,6 +2,10 @@ Revision history for Perl extension Plack
    
     Take a look at http://github.com/miyagawa/Plack/issues for the planned changes before 1.0 release.
    
    +0.9931  Fri Apr 16 23:52:27 PDT 2010
    +        - replace kyoto.jpg test image file with smaller baybridge.jpg to strip down the tarball size
    +          from 2.5MB to 212KB.
    +
     0.9930  Tue Apr 13 20:18:06 PDT 2010
             - Added Plack::Handler::Net::FastCGI (chansen)
             - Made Test::TCP a hard dependency since Plack::Test needs it
Commits on Apr 14, 2010
  1. Checking in changes prior to tagging of version 0.9930.

    miyagawa committed Apr 14, 2010
    Changelog diff is:
    
    diff --git a/Changes b/Changes
    index 0f0ab40..341971f 100644
    --- a/Changes
    +++ b/Changes
    @@ -2,6 +2,12 @@ Revision history for Perl extension Plack
    
     Take a look at http://github.com/miyagawa/Plack/issues for the planned changes before 1.0 release.
    
    +0.9930  Tue Apr 13 20:18:06 PDT 2010
    +        - Added Plack::Handler::Net::FastCGI (chansen)
    +        - Made Test::TCP a hard dependency since Plack::Test needs it
    +        - Added Delayed loader for Starlet and Starman (clkao)
    +        - Hide logger middleware from log4perl's caller stack (haarg)
    +
     0.9929  Wed Mar 31 00:33:10 PDT 2010
             - Middleware::JSONP: Simplified code and does not support IO response body type
             - fcgi.t: skip tests with lighttpd < 1.4.17 per CPAN Testers #7040400
  2. Added docs for Delayed loader

    miyagawa committed Apr 14, 2010
Commits on Apr 12, 2010
  1. Turn on autoflush(1)

    chansen committed Apr 12, 2010
  2. Delayed loader.

    clkao committed Apr 12, 2010
  3. s/FCGI::PP/Net::FastCGI/g

    miyagawa committed Apr 12, 2010
Commits on Apr 11, 2010
Commits on Apr 10, 2010
  1. Fix Apache2 docs

    miyagawa committed Apr 10, 2010
  2. upped Net::FastCGI dep

    miyagawa committed Apr 10, 2010
  3. Merge branch 'chansen/fcgi-pp'

    miyagawa committed Apr 10, 2010
Commits on Apr 9, 2010
  1. Added support for FCGI_ABORT_REQUEST

    chansen committed Apr 9, 2010
    Added support for standard error
    Added support for debugging/tracing FastCGI protocol
    Moved server capabilities from globals vars to instance
Commits on Apr 8, 2010
  1. fix pods

    miyagawa committed Apr 8, 2010
Commits on Apr 5, 2010
  1. docs

    miyagawa committed Apr 5, 2010
Commits on Apr 2, 2010
  1. shebang

    miyagawa committed Apr 2, 2010
Commits on Apr 1, 2010
  1. s/detach/daemonize/ Fixes gh-101

    miyagawa committed Apr 1, 2010